Priyanka Chopra Honors Dharmendra’s Legacy: No Godfather, Yet Enduring Impact

Source: Priyanka Chopra says Dharmendra had ‘no godfather’ yet managed to make a permanent mark in a ‘tough industry’ | Bollywood (2025-11-25)

Priyanka Chopra recently paid heartfelt tribute to the legendary Dharmendra, who passed away at age 89, highlighting his remarkable journey in Bollywood despite lacking a traditional “godfather.” She recalled how Dharmendra and his family warmly welcomed her during her early days in the industry, exemplifying his kindness and humility. Dharmendra’s career, spanning over six decades, was marked by his versatility and enduring popularity, making him a true icon without the backing of influential industry connections. His death marks the end of an era, prompting widespread tributes from Bollywood stars and fans alike. Beyond his acting prowess, Dharmendra was known for his philanthropic efforts, including supporting rural development and education initiatives. His influence extended beyond cinema, inspiring generations of actors and filmmakers. Recent facts reveal that Dharmendra was awarded the Padma Bhushan in 2012 for his contributions to Indian cinema, and he was also a successful producer and politician.
